Background
Battery (Battery) refers to a device that converts chemical energy into electrical energy in a cup, tank, or other container or portion of a composite container that holds an electrolyte solution and metal electrodes to generate an electric current. Has a positive electrode and a negative electrode. With the advancement of technology, batteries generally refer to small devices that can generate electrical energy. Such as a solar cell. The performance parameters of the battery are mainly electromotive force, capacity, specific energy and resistance. The battery is used as an energy source, can obtain current which has stable voltage and current, is stably supplied for a long time and is slightly influenced by the outside, has simple structure, convenient carrying, simple and easy charging and discharging operation, is not influenced by the outside climate and temperature, has stable and reliable performance, and plays a great role in various aspects of modern social life.
An outdoor Power supply (Portable energy storage Power supply; emergency Power supply; UPS uninterrupted Power supply; English: Power outdoor, Portable Power station) is a Portable energy storage Power supply which is Portable by a person, is internally provided with a lithium ion battery and can store electric energy. The capacity of a common portable energy storage power supply is defined between 80Wh and 5000Wh, and the power is between 80W and 3000W. The power supply device provides convenient power for various electric equipment, and is particularly applied to occasions without external power supply.
However, most portable energy storage power supplies in the market at present are solar panels which cannot fix the tops of the portable energy storage power supplies well, and the portable energy storage power supplies are generally used outdoors and the like under the condition that commercial power is not fixed, so that the use environments of the portable energy storage power supplies are relatively special, most portable energy storage power supplies are not subjected to dustproof treatment, dust can be accumulated in the power supplies, and circuit faults can be caused.

When the solar panel dustproof device works (or is used), when the solar panel 9 is placed at the top of the device shell 1, under the action of gravity of the solar panel 9, the dustproof baffle 501 in the hydraulic dustproof device 5 is automatically opened, so that the gear rod 901 can be in normal contact with the metal block 403, at the moment, the gear rod 901 is movably connected with the buckle 408, and under the action of the gear 404 and the buckle 408, the solar panel 9 can be normally fixed.
